The Fighting Irish defeated the No. 19 Gamecocks 45-38 in the Gator Bowl on Friday by running 22 offensive plays that produced gains of 10+ yards, including two of the biggest pass plays of the season.
No. 21 Notre Dame outgained the Gamecocks by a 356-111 yard margin in the second half to wrap up the 2022 season with a 45-38 win over a ranked SEC opponent.

It's been 112 days since Tyler Buchner last suited up. Despite missing so much time, the sophomore quarterback has progressed quickly during bowl prep. “After 14 practices, I think he's ready to roll,” Freeman said. “He's been magnificent in practice.”
